Carr Manor Community School is an all-through school at an exciting phase of expansion and development across both our Primary and Secondary Phases. We are proud of our caring and inclusive reputation and have a strong team of professionals committed to developing and delivering a broad curriculum to children aged 2-19.
We are one of the founding partners of the Leeds Learning Alliance and we are looking forward to further developing our partnerships over the forthcoming months and years.
It is essential that applicants wanting to join our team share our school's ethos, which is firmly rooted in a restorative approach.
